Guild Bargaining Bulletin #18

Can a Snowflake Start an Avalanche?

The Guild and the Company met for the first time in over eight months today (Feb. 14, 2001). During the two hour meeting the Guild presented the Company with changes to five relatively minor sections of its proposal. The changes were intended to create an atmosphere where agreement was possible. The changes were acceptances of, or movement toward, company positions.

"An avalanche begins with a snowflake," the Guild told Company negotiators. The Guild asked the company to respond to the changes with movements of its own.

Company negotiators said two of the Guild's changes were not just acceptance of the Company positions, and would require more study.

The Company also asked the Guild committee to consider its proposal for a pension-401(k) reopener, and to accept the medical benefits it imposed in January 2000.

The Guild renewed its request for pension and 401(k) information necessary for negotiators to evaluate company pension plans. This was rejected. The Guild also asked the company to explain its proposal regarding replacing medical plans with ones that are "substantially equivalent." The Company declined to provide examples of what changes would and would not meet the "substantially equivalent" standard. "I don't think that would be helpful," the company spokesman said. The Guild asked the company to reconsider its position.

The Guild asked to schedule another bargaining session, so that issues raised today could be discussed. The company said it would get back in touch later. No additional negotiating dates have been scheduled.
